Warning Signs You Need Bathtub Overflow Water Removal

Catching the signs of a bathtub overflow early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ors in your bathroom can show a hidden leak or water damage. Don’t ignore these smells – they can be a sign of a bigger problem.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can show a leak or water damage. Don’t wait – these stains can spread and cause more damage if left unchecked.

Soft or Sagging Floors

Soft or sagging floors can show water damage or a hidden leak. Don’t ignore these signs – they can be a sign of a bigger problem.

Visible Water Damage or Leaks

Visible water damage or leaks in your bathtub or surrounding area can show a serious problem. Don’t wait – these signs can show a bigger issue.

Unusual Sounds or Gurgling

Unusual sounds or gurgling noises coming from your bathtub or pipes can show a leak or water damage. Don’t ignore these signs – they can be a sign of a bigger problem.

Bathtub Overflow Water Removal Cost in Hilton, NY

The cost of bathtub overflow water removal in Hilton, NY can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Restoration and repair $1,000 – $5,000 Extent of damage, materials needed, and labor required
Dehumidification and air drying $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, equipment needed, and duration of service
Hidden leak detection and repair $500 – $2,000 Severity of damage, equipment needed, and labor required
Insurance claim navigation $0 – $1,000 Complexity of claim, paperwork involved, and communication with insurance company

Common Questions About Bathtub Overflow Water Removal

Q: How long does bathtub overflow water removal take?

We’ll work quickly to contain the damage and restore your property to its original state, usually within 3-5 days. But, this timeframe may v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.

Q: Is bathtub overflow water removal covered by insurance?

Yes, bathtub overflow water removal is typically covered by homeowners insurance. We’ll work closely with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.

Q: What causes bathtub overflows?

Bathtub overflows can be caused by a variety of factors, including clogged drains, worn-out seals, and sudden bursts of water pressure.

Q: Can I prevent bathtub overflows?

Yes, you can take steps to prevent bathtub overflows, including regularly checking your drain for clogs and ensuring that your bathtub is properly sealed.

Q: How do I know if I need bathtub overflow water removal?

You’ll know if you need bathtub overflow water removal if you notice water damage, musty odors, or unusual sounds coming from your bathtub or surrounding area.
